Abstract
Through theoretic analysis,it's concluded that the lubricating oil flow increases with the increase of the angular velocity of the driving shaft.It's proposed that an angular velocity sensor be installed on the driving shaft to adjust the flow valve by controlling the controller to realize the dynamic change of lubricating oil flow with the angular velocity of the driving shaft.Furthermore,the effect of lubricating oil flow on the towing torque is analyzed.The result shows that there is a secondary function relation between the towing torque and lubricating oil flow.At the beginning of loading,lubricating oil flow is controlled to realize small-power loading of the hydroviscous dynamometer.关键词
